What does the NCES F-33 data show for Minnesota?

Minnesota reports 352 public school districts in the NCES Common Core of Data FY2022 Local Education Agency Finance Survey, with an estimated average teacher salary of $94,946. That places the state in the upper third of US teacher-pay rankings — #14 of 51, meaningfully above the national F-33 estimate of $82,292 (+15.4%). The state's public schools serve 800,886 students across these districts.

Among enrolling districts, pay varies widely: RED LAKE PUBLIC SCHOOL DISTRICT reports the highest estimated average salary at $140,583, while FERGUS FALLS PUBLIC SCHOOL DISTRICT sits at the lower end at $62,210 — a spread of $78,373 between top and bottom reporting districts. Licensing rules, state aid formulas, collective bargaining density, and local tax bases all drive this intra-state variation. Urban and suburban districts with larger tax bases typically lead, while rural districts often lag despite lower cost of living.

Teacher compensation here reflects both state policy choices — the statutory minimum salary schedule, pension funding levels, licensure reciprocity — and the funding formula that determines how much state aid each district receives per pupil. A #14 national rank signals where Minnesota sits in the competition for teachers against neighboring states; teacher shortage areas typically correlate with lower pay rank. Figures below are per-district estimates derived from the F-33 instructional salary expenditure field (Z33) divided by estimated teacher FTE — a district-level aggregate, not individual salary records.
